Short Course: Introduction to filmmaking
In this course, the participants will be introduced to some basic elements of filmmaking, such as storytelling, storyboards, lighting, filming and editing. Later, they will be divided into groups to work on making a short film.
Session 1: Screenwriting and Storyboarding
Course for Children
Date: Sunday, 21 November 2021
Timings: 5:00 pm–7:00 pm
Ages: 11–15
Languages: English and Arabic
This session provides a solid foundation in the essentials of screenwriting, from concept, character and story to plot, dialogue and structure. Guided by a professional screenwriter, participants will learn how to shape their story, create compelling characters, construct scenes and write effective dialogue. Through writing exercises, participants will implement the screenwriting guidelines discussed in the class and then create storyboards for their scenes.
Session 2: Lighting and Filming
Date: Tuesday, 23 November 2021
Timings: 5:00 pm–7:00 pm
Ages: 11–15
Languages: English and Arabic
The proper lighting of spaces and subjects is an essential part of any film or video project. This session will offer an overview of lighting theory as well as demonstrations of different techniques for using natural and artificial light in the best possible way to tell a story. Participants will then work in groups and start filming their ideas.
Session 3: Editing and Production
Date: Thursday, 25 November 2021
Timings: 5:00 pm–7:00 pm
Ages: 11–15
Languages: English and Arabic
In this session, participants will learn the basic principles of editing, such as capturing footage, using the timeline, transitions and adding titles and credits. Participants will then watch the short film they produced and have a discussion with the teaching artist.
